37/*
38 * Register definitions for the SiS 900 and SiS 7016 chipsets. The
39 * 7016 is actually an older chip and some of its registers differ
40 * from the 900, however the core operational registers are the same:
41 * the differences lie in the OnNow/Wake on LAN stuff which we don't
42 * use anyway. The 7016 needs an external MII compliant PHY while the
43 * SiS 900 has one built in. All registers are 32-bits wide.
44 */
45
46/* Registers common to SiS 900 and SiS 7016 */
47#define SIS_CSR			0x00
48#define SIS_CFG			0x04
49#define SIS_EECTL		0x08
50#define SIS_PCICTL		0x0C
51#define SIS_ISR			0x10
52#define SIS_IMR			0x14
53#define SIS_IER			0x18
54#define SIS_PHYCTL		0x1C
55#define SIS_TX_LISTPTR		0x20
56#define SIS_TX_CFG		0x24
57#define SIS_RX_LISTPTR		0x30
58#define SIS_RX_CFG		0x34
59#define SIS_FLOWCTL		0x38
60#define SIS_RXFILT_CTL		0x48
61#define SIS_RXFILT_DATA		0x4C
62#define SIS_PWRMAN_CTL		0xB0
63#define SIS_PWERMAN_WKUP_EVENT	0xB4
64#define SIS_WKUP_FRAME_CRC	0xBC
65#define SIS_WKUP_FRAME_MASK0	0xC0
66#define SIS_WKUP_FRAME_MASKXX	0xEC
